Just like training any other body part can improve its performance, so too can training one’s eyes, improve their overall performance.
These eye exercises are specially designed to strengthen and improve your eye muscles, improve their focusing and movements, as well as stimulate the vision center of the brain.
Before trying these exercises check with your doctor to see if they will benefit you.
Directional Eye Exercises
1. Up and Down – Look up and focus on what you see then look down and focus on what you see. Do this 5 times and then pause for a minute and then repeat this 3 more times in total.
2. Left and right – Look to the left and focus on what you see then look to the right and focus on what you see. Do this 5 times and then pause for a minute and then repeat this 3 more times in total.
3. Diagonal vision exercise – Look straight ahead and focus. Look down and focus, to the left and focus. Then move your eyes diagonally and look up and to the right and focus. Do this 5 times and then pause for a minute and then repeat this 3 more times in total.

The Figure 8 for Relaxed Eye Movement and Clear Vision
This is an excellent exercise to improve controlling the movement of the eyes.
Imagine a giant figure 8 on the floor, about 3 meters in front of you.
Follow the figure 8 lining with your eyes, slowly.
Trace it one way for a few minutes slowly and then trace it the other way for a few minutes.
Use both figures, horizontal and vertical.
Rolling Your Eyes for Improved Vision
1. Roll your eyes in a circle – Look to the left and slowly roll your eyes in a circle clockwise. Do this 5 times and then pause for a minute and then repeat this 3 more times in total.
2. Roll your Eyes in expanding circles –Follow this image slowly with focus with your eyes. Do this 5 times and then pause for a minute and then repeat this 3 more times in total.
To finish your eye workout, close your eyes or lay/sit in a peaceful pitch black room. This works like a cool down.
